How to check variable if present or not ?
I have a main form and put the :global.gdate, When I call the others form
I want to use the :global.gdate.
I wirte a trigger "when new form instance" for each form (except main form) so I can get :global.date.
But I can only running this program from main form, if I am running the form without the main form, the error message :global.gdate does not exists.
Question:
Is it posible to check if :global.gdate is exists or not ?
maybe somthing like :
IF get_variable(:global.gdate) IS NULL THEN --?????????
:global.gdate := sysdate;
END IF;
From Oracle documentation:
DEFAULT_VALUE built-in
Description
Copies an indicated value to an indicated variable if the variable's current value is NULL. If the variable's current value is not NULL, DEFAULT_VALUE does nothing. Therefore, for text items this built-in works identically to using the COPY built-in on a NULL item. If the variable is an undefined global variable, Form Builder creates the variable.
Syntax
PROCEDURE DEFAULT_VALUE
(value_string VARCHAR2,
variable_name VARCHAR2);
Example:
** Built-in: DEFAULT_VALUE
** Example: Make sure a Global variable is defined by
** assigning some value to it with Default_Value
BEGIN
** Default the value of GLOBAL.Command_Indicator if it is
** NULL or does not exist.
Default_Value('***','global.command_indicator');
** If the global variable equals the string we defaulted
** it to above, then it must have not existed before
IF :Global.Command_Indicator = '***' THEN
Message('You must call this screen from the Main Menu');
RAISE Form_Trigger_Failure;
END IF;
END;
Similar Messages
-
How to check table is creating or not
Hi,
I am creating only one table by running a table creation script(table.sql) which contain 366 partition.but I dont know whether table is creating or not.it is taking long time,sometimes I feel like script is hanging.even before running the script I have even spooled but spool file shows nothing. so how to check table is creating or not from background? can anyone please let me know abt this.this is bit urgent
sql>spool table.log
sql>@table_partition.sqlhi,
I am running the script table_partition which consist of 366 partition and 31 sub partition but the script is hanging.there is no hint in alert log file or anything wat might be the reason is it because of extent size? as extent size for this tablespace where table has to be create is 1mb,wat i suspect is do i need to set for higher value inorder to avoid this?
with regards;
Boo -
How to check Reconcilliation has happened or not for a payment document
Hi,
How to check Reconcilliation has happened or not for a payment document? Payment doc ABCDEF was created on 2nd. Now i am not sure whethr RECON has happend ot not
Please help.Dear,
If you have made payment to vendor and want to know whether reconciliation happened or not then check if this document exist in table BSIK then reconciliation has not been done.
Regards,
Chintan Joshi. -
How to check table is NULL or not when a form load?
How to check table is NULL or not when a form load?
I want to make the form when it load it check the data in table, if there are no data in table other form will be load.
Sorry for bad English...Maybe you can do this in form1's Form_Open event:
if dcount("*", "table1") = 0 then
Cancel = True
Docmd.Openform "form2"
end if
-Tom. Microsoft Access MVP -
How to check one table exist or not in SAP
Hi, Gurus:
How to check one table exist or not in the SAP.
Thanks,Hi,
Query the table DD02L..
Select single * from DD02L where tabname = 'Your table name'
AND TABCLASS = 'TRANSP'. " For transparent tables.
Thanks
Naren -
How to check internal table sorted or not
Hi all
I need to check internal table sorted or not which is without header line and having only one field and six values. please let me know how to check it is sorted or not because i need to display message if it is not sorted.
thanks,
MinalHi Minal,
Go through this info.
Sorted tables
This is the most appropriate type if you need a table which is sorted as you fill it. You fill sorted tables using the INSERT statement. Entries are inserted according to the sort sequence defined through the table key. Any illegal entries are recognized as soon as you try to add them to the table. The response time for key access is logarithmically proportional to the number of table entries, since the system always uses a binary search. Sorted tables are particularly useful for partially sequential processing in a LOOP if you specify the beginning of the table key in the WHERE condition.
Stable sort
The option
SORT <itab> ... STABLE.
allows you to perform a stable sort, that is, the relative sequence of lines that are unchanged by the sort is not changed. If you do not use the STABLE option, the sort sequence is not preserved. If you sort a table several times by the same key, the sequence of the table entries will change in each sort. However, a stable sort takes longer than an unstable sort.
Examples
DATA: BEGIN OF LINE,
LAND(3) TYPE C,
NAME(10) TYPE C,
AGE TYPE I,
WEIGHT TYPE P DECIMALS 2,
END OF LINE.
DATA ITAB LIKE STANDARD TABLE OF LINE WITH NON-UNIQUE KEY LAND.
LINE-LAND = 'G'. LINE-NAME = 'Hans'.
LINE-AGE = 20. LINE-WEIGHT = '80.00'.
APPEND LINE TO ITAB.
LINE-LAND = 'USA'. LINE-NAME = 'Nancy'.
LINE-AGE = 35. LINE-WEIGHT = '45.00'.
APPEND LINE TO ITAB.
LINE-LAND = 'USA'. LINE-NAME = 'Howard'.
LINE-AGE = 40. LINE-WEIGHT = '95.00'.
APPEND LINE TO ITAB.
LINE-LAND = 'GB'. LINE-NAME = 'Jenny'.
LINE-AGE = 18. LINE-WEIGHT = '50.00'.
APPEND LINE TO ITAB.
LINE-LAND = 'F'. LINE-NAME = 'Michele'.
LINE-AGE = 30. LINE-WEIGHT = '60.00'.
APPEND LINE TO ITAB.
LINE-LAND = 'G'. LINE-NAME = 'Karl'.
LINE-AGE = 60. LINE-WEIGHT = '75.00'.
APPEND LINE TO ITAB.
PERFORM LOOP_AT_ITAB.
SORT ITAB.
PERFORM LOOP_AT_ITAB.
SORT ITAB.
PERFORM LOOP_AT_ITAB.
SORT ITAB STABLE.
PERFORM LOOP_AT_ITAB.
SORT ITAB DESCENDING BY LAND WEIGHT ASCENDING.
PERFORM LOOP_AT_ITAB.
FORM LOOP_AT_ITAB.
LOOP AT ITAB INTO LINE.
WRITE: / LINE-LAND, LINE-NAME, LINE-AGE, LINE-WEIGHT.
ENDLOOP.
SKIP.
ENDFORM.
************rewords some points if it is helpful.
Rgds,
P.Naganjana Reddy -
How to check oracle properly installed or not?
Hello Friends,
How to check oracle properly installed or not. cause during installation time the person who installed faced many problems. we have RISK base IBM p5 Series server and Oracle 10g RAC.
i want to check installation made properly or not.
Thanks,
Nikunj PatelInstallation for RAC environments means you are not only talking about one single installation, but several installations, and the number of installations and checking processes depend on factors such as the clusterware you are using, if you are using the Oracle clusterware or the proprietary clusterware, if you are using a separate oracle home to install the ASM or if you are using the same oracle home for both, the ASM and the RDBMS.
First you must ensure you have installed all prerequisites according to your platform, i.e. patches, packages, kernel parameters, etc. which are listed at the install guide corresponding to your platform. Then you should use the cluvfy (cluster verifier tool) to check if the different install phases are properly installed
The most critical and most of the times, problematic installation phase is the clusterware. So you should specify if you installed the Oracle clusterware or the proprietary clusterware. In a RAC environment if your clusterware is not properly installed, most probably you won't have a running RAC, so if your environment is functional there you may have high probabilities that it is OK, but to make sure, launch the cluvfy tool.
The cluvfy tool verifies the process since the beginning and it ensures your environment meets the required minimum requirements to be at an operational level, it checks the pre/post install phases for the clusterware, pre/post install of the rdbms, and it is launched from the OS. It can be obtained as a standalone product or you can use the one found at the clusterware Oracle Home. For further references on this tool I suggest you to read this
Oracle® Database Oracle Clusterware and Oracle Real Application Clusters Installation Guide
10g Release 2 (10.2) for AIX
Part Number B14201-04
~ Madrid -
Hi All,
I am checking in CMOD include. It has lot of code. Example: When 'ZFISPER' . I think that is Variable Technical name. How to check that variable and in Which Query it is.
Please let me know...
Thanks in advance..
KNHello,
You can go over into transaction code RSA1 and then on your left hand side you will be able to see lot of tabs in terms of Modeling, Administration, Transport Connection and so on.
So go ahead and click on the tab "Transport Connection" and in the next screen you will be able to see all object types available in your environment.
Please go ahead and open up the section "Query Elements", if you are not able to see the same, on the left under the transport connection you will see the folder "SAP Transport" and within that the option called "Object Types", just click on it once and all the object types which are available for transports will show up.
Once you have selected Query Elements, under that you will be able to see different Query related objects and you will be having "Variable". When you drilldown on Variable folder you can double click "Select Objects" and select your appropriate variable name.
One other way to proactively get a list of variables available in your system and to find out on which InfoObject they have been buill, please go into transaction se16 or se12 and then enter the table name RSZGLOBV.
In this table you can get a list of all the variables along with the metadata without trying to parse through one by one variable.
Thanks
Dharma. -
How to check program is running or not
Hi,
Is it possible to check whether a program is running or not?
I know when you try to compile a package which is running, oracle does not allow you compile it, it hangs. That is, somehow, Oracle knows the program is running. How can we check this information?
Suppose procedure below. If i ran it in one session, how can check that procedure p is running in other session?
I searched the forum. There is one( checking if a package procedure is already running ) thread but noone has replied.
Thanks....
SQL> DROP TABLE T;
Table dropped
SQL> CREATE TABLE T AS SELECT DUMMY D FROM DUAL;
Table created
SQL> CREATE OR REPLACE PROCEDURE p IS
2 s VARCHAR2(12);
3 BEGIN
4 SELECT d INTO s FROM t;
5 LOOP
6 EXIT WHEN s = 'Y';
7 SELECT d INTO s FROM t;
8 END LOOP;
9 END p;
10 /
Procedure created
SQL> exec p;I found the answer from another thread.( Package Compilation Hangs )
Answer is : http://www.ixora.com.au/scripts/sql/executing_packages.sql -
How to check patch level applied or not?
how can i check that bellow patches are applied or not as mentioned for patch no 7427746.
- FA.M mini-pack or later
or
- FIN_PF.E or later
and
-ATG H RUP4() or higher
thanksHi;
how can i check that bellow patches are applied or not as mentioned for patch no 7427746.
- FA.M mini-pack or later
or
- FIN_PF.E or later
and
-ATG H RUP4() or higherPlease check :
- How to check which Techstack patchsets have been applied [390864.1 ]
Regard
Helios -
How to check mail already read or not?
Hi everyone
I am developing an application using javamail api.
I have no idea how to check mail is already read or answered or seen using javamail api.
I need to fetch new mail every time. I used DELETE flag ,its working fine but it also delete mail permanently from inbox.
I want to fetch new mail and already fetched mail is also reside in inbox. but not fetched next time.
Pls help me.Either I'm not understanding you, or you're not understanding JavaMail.
First, the POP3 protocol supports no permanent flags, as explained in
http://java.sun.com/products/javamail/javadocs/com/sun/mail/pop3/package-summary.html
You can set flags on messages, but they won't persist after you close the folder.
If you set the DELETED flag and close the folder and expunged deleted messages,
the messages are gone for good.
That's not a JavaMail limitation, that's a POP3 protocol limitation.
Again, as explained in the link above, to determine which messages are new you'll
need to keep some state in your application about which messages you've seen
and compare that state with the current state of the INBOX. You can use the POP3
specific UIDL command to help with this.
Does that help? -
How to check oracle is running or not
Hi,
Can any one help me the command to check whether oracle is running or not, in UNIX flatform.How to check the Disk+Work proess is running or not.Option1 :Logon to SAPDBA...U will be able to see whether Oracle is running or not.
Option 2:
Sqlplus /nolog;
connect / as sysdba;
startup;
If it is already running: you will get msg that Oracle is already running
Oprion 3: ps -eaf|grep ora
to determine whether disp+work is running or not:
Option 1: ps -eaf|grep sap
Option 2: dpmon pf = <path of instance profile>
Reward Points if helpful! -
How to check value is numeric or not
hi how to check whether a value is numeric or not.
example. data : x type n.
x = 12345.
Now how to check whether X contains numeric value or not.Hi,
If your type is 'N' there is no way that 'X' can have any value apart for numberics (i.e. 0 - 9).
You can also check that as follows.
Data: num_list(10) type c value '0123456789',
x type n.
X = '12345'.
This is more useful if your X is of type C.
if X CO num_list.
Its only numeric
else.
its contains non numeric
endif.
Regards,
Sesh -
How to check variable type?
Hi,
How to get variable type if I want to check variable
type.which function or class do thsi.Thanks
MarkI believe you use the function typeof()
ie
var myString:String = "test";
trace(typeof(myString)); //should output string -
How to check Category is filled or not in Service ticket?
I have requirement to check the category field (CAT_GUID) is filled with value or not.
I would like to check this category field in the Badi zOrderSave of service ticket.
How I can accomplish this issue?
Your reply is appreciated.
BanuHi Banu,
I understood that you have to check Category field.
Please, "se"nd m"e an "e"mail" with a print screen highlighting the information that u need.
caiqueescaler hotmail com
Regards,
Caíque Escaler
Edited by: Caíque Escaler on Jun 23, 2010 8:34 PM
Maybe you are looking for
-
Does iDVD really take 6 HOURS to burn a DVD???
This is my first DVD to burn on the iMac. Previously I have used DVD Shrink on a Windows machine which took about 1 hour from rip to completed burn. I have already used the Hand Brake program to create a mp4 and I am using iDVD to burn a new DVD and
-
SSRS 2012 problem with excel export
Hello I updated SSRS 2005 up to SSRS 2012. When I exported report in excel (xlsx) I got following warning : "We found a problem with some conent in 'filnename.xlsx'.Do you want to try to recover as much as we can? if you trust the source of this wor
-
SAP GRC AC 5.3 CUP Risk Analysis issue
Hi all, I have assigned a new SoD Role to a user, who has been given previously other SoD Roles that were authorized to assingn, then I launched the Risk Analysis and it shows the risk between the previously SoD Roles, but I want to see the new posib
-
Apple Mac OS X - Menu bar icon integration
Hi all, I am trying to figure out if Adobe AIR is a good solution for me since I am creating an app which should be compatible with multple platforms and in order to save development time, AIR could be handy. One of the requirements is that the Mac O
-
cant download my raw photos to element 12. I have canon 70d. pc